Gross monthly income works out to about $8,818, and the 30% rule supports up to $2,645/mo in rent. Millburn's median rent of $4,419 exceeds that threshold by $1,774/mo, putting a registered nurse salary into the rent-burdened range here. A registered nurse works roughly 86.9 hours a month to cover that rent.

Rent is the single largest fixed cost most renters carry, and the rent-to-income ratio is the simplest measure of whether a city is livable on a given salary. For renters earning a typical registered-nurse income, the 30% rule supports about $2,360 a month in rent. That margin covers comfortable one-bedroom rent in the vast majority of US metros but tightens significantly in the highest-rent coastal cities, where rent can claim 40% or more of an RN paycheck.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ived New Jersey state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Millburn, NJ.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
